At the Monaco Grand Prix it often only goes two ways. Either it's a boring parade, or it's a chaotic race full of excitement. The latter is certainly the case when there is some rain. The 2008 race is a good example of this, but it can hardly be any crazier than the 1996 Monaco GP.
Beforehand the race seemed to become a prey for Michael Schumacher. Two weeks earlier he had already achieved his first pole position for Ferrari at the circuit of Imola and did so thinly on Saturday in Monaco. The difference with the Williams of Damon Hill was more than half a second. So on the tight street circuit of Monaco he had a good chance of his first victory for the Scuderia.
On Sunday, however, it was already soaking wet before the start of the race and that would have major consequences in the first lap. In the run-up to the start of the race it seemed to dry up a bit so many drivers opted for intermediates. Schumacher was one of them.
How long that went well, you can see this Saturday on the Youtube channel of Formula 1. Due to the corona crisis, Formula 1 broadcasts a classic race every weekend and this time it is the turn of the tombola in Monaco. The broadcast starts at 14:00 GMT.
